As another option for the 235 I would suggest you consider a pair of Carter/Webers. I found that the supply of decent Rochester and Carter cores was fairly limited so I made the transition to a single Holley/Weber on my stock 57 235 in my 54 truck. It performed flawlessly out of the box. Totally eliminated the rich condition and leaking problems of the 50 year old Rochesters.
On my replacement 1960 "built" engine, I went with the dual Carter/Webers as I was building for low-end torque. As with the single H/W, the dual C/W's performed flawlessly right out of the box. Set and forget. I've put over 4500 miles on my 60 engine and haven't had the first hiccup!!! My truck will cruise all day at 70 mph@2000 rpm's and my AVERAGE fuel consumption varies between 18-20 mpg. I know it could be better if I were a bit more attentive to my speed and driving style.
If you were camming for a higher torque/rpm, you might be wise to consider a pair of H/w's as they are rated at a bit higher CFM. Granted the H/W and C/W's are visually "different" from the stock style carbs but they certainly make up for it by being great performers, a reasonable initial cost, in the ease of installation and tuning and don't seem to be effected by the blended fuels we are faced with using.
Tom Langdon of Stovebolt Engineering Co. is a great source of information on this setup as well as other 235 related info. I wouldn't hesitate to use this C/W setup on any vehicle that I wanted to perform flawlessly.
